A train trip from Alderley Edge to Stevenston takes about 5hrs 23 mins on average, covering roughly 190 miles (306 kilometres). With around 19 trains running each day, there's plenty of flexibility for your travel plans. If you book in advance, you can grab tickets starting from just £15.00, making it a budget-friendly option for those who plan ahead.

The station provides essential facilities for travelers, ensuring a comfortable journey. The ticket office operates from early morning until early afternoon on Saturdays, though it remains closed during weekdays and Sundays. However, you can still purchase tickets or collect pre-purchased tickets from the accessible ticket machines located on-site. It's worth noting that smartcards are supported at the station, aligning with modern, streamlined travel conveniences.
For those with specific accessibility needs, Alderley Edge station offers partial step-free access and is categorized as a scooter-friendly location, making it navigable for those using mobility aids. There's no waiting room available, yet the station ensures passenger security with the presence of CCTV. Unfortunately, facilities such as restrooms, baby changing rooms, and refreshment outlets are not provided, so plan accordingly.
Beyond the station itself, Alderley Edge is well-connected through various transport links. Although direct bicycle hire services aren't available, the station provides limited bicycle storage facilities for those traveling with bikes. For taxi services, visitors can arrange their rides using online platforms such as Cab4You. Bus services are also in operation with convenient stops nearby, allowing for easy intermodal transfer.

It's essential to set expectations for what you'll find at Stevenston train station. This Category A station has step-free access across all platforms, making it accessible for travelers with limited mobility. Although there are no ticket offices or machines onsite, an induction loop is available to assist hearing-impaired passengers. While the station lacks a staffed ticket office, assistance can be found at customer help points, ensuring that any traveler queries aren't left unaddressed. And for a bit of comfort, seating areas are provided for your convenience.
Additionally, though you won't find shopping kiosks or refreshment facilities, you'll appreciate the station's practicality if you're seeking straightforward access to train services. The absence of advanced amenities contrasts with the station's lovely straightforwardness, providing a serene start or end to your journey.
When it comes to onward travel, Stevenston station connects efficiently with other modes of transport. If your travel involves a change to a bus service, you can find them directly outside the station. Taxis are also readily available, and you can check specific arrangements at TrainTaxi. For public transport enthusiasts, bus details are accessible via Traveline Scotland, which offers 24-hour assistance to plan your onward journey.
